Nathan Adrian Stays Consistent With Another 48 Second 100 Free in Mesa

There are few things in the sport of swimming that stay true year after year.

  1. Cal swimming will place in the top two at NCAA’s
  2. Emory women’s swimming will be national champions
  3. Nathan Adrian will swim a 48 second in-season 100 free

It has become almost expected that Adrian will post a solid in-season 100 free at these Pro Swim Series meets. That did not change on Friday night in Mesa as Adrian posted a 48.84 to win the 100 free final.

Adrian finished ahead of fellow 2017 World Championship team member Michael Chadwick (49.17). Adrian is now 29 years of age and is still a force to be reckoned with in the world of swimming. That won’t change in 2018, even despite Caeleb Dressel breaking every barrier imaginable in the sport.

Bruno Blaskovic (50.01), Jesse Novak (50.69), Andrej Barna (51.01), Ryan Murphy (51.18), Matias Koski (51.35) and Scott Mcgillivary (51.52) also swam in the A-final.
